Something new and exciting coming to Stroud

Generation Games

Sunday 29th March 2009

Stratford Park Leisure Centre

9.30am - 4.30pm

Stroud District Council are excited to present The Generation Games; a chance for young and old alike to participate in a variety of sports and activities. The activities on offer are suitable for participants from 5yrs-100yrs old and are being put on by local clubs and deliverers to introduce people within the Stroud district to new and exciting ways to stay active, improve your health and most of all have fun!

What will be on offer?

All children and adults participating in the event will have the chance to try a range of alternative activities. The activities involved in the day's events are:

Roller Skating Aerobics Archery Sports Hall Athletics Ultimate Frisbee Circus Skills

'Have a go' activities within the day include:

Rock Climbing Fitness Challenge

How much does it cost?

It will cost �1 per child and �2 per adult(s) (Get one place free if more than 3 people from the same family take part).
